2. WHAT IS PUBLIC DOMAIN SOFTWARE?
• Public domain software refers to software that is not protected by any form of
intellectual property rights, including copyright, patents, or trademarks.
• This means that anyone can use, modify, and distribute the software without any
legal restrictions.
• In other words, public domain software is free for anyone to use for any purpose,
without needing to pay a fee or seek permission from the original creators.
3. ADVANTAGES OF PUBLIC DOMAIN SOFTWARE:
1. Cost Savings: One of the primary benefits of public domain software is that it is free to use, modify, and distribute.
This can be particularly helpful for individuals and organizations with limited budgets, as it eliminates the need to pay
licensing fees for proprietary software.
2. Flexibility: Because there are no legal restrictions on how the software can be used or modified, users have a high
degree of flexibility in adapting the software to meet their specific needs. This can be particularly useful for research
purposes or for developing custom software solutions.
3. Wide Availability: Public domain software is often widely available and can be easily downloaded from the internet.
This can be particularly helpful for individuals and organizations with limited access to proprietary software, or for
those who need to access software quickly and easily.
4. DISADVANTAGES OF PUBLIC DOMAIN SOFTWARE:
1. Lack of Support: Because public domain software is typically created and maintained by volunteers, there is often little or no
support available for users who encounter issues or need help with the software. This can be particularly problematic for
organizations with complex software needs or for individuals who are not technically savvy.
2. Potential Legal Issues: Because public domain software is not protected by any form of intellectual property, there is a risk
that users may inadvertently infringe on the rights of others when using or distributing the software. This can be particularly
problematic for organizations that rely on software to support their business operations.
3. Quality Control: Because there are no legal restrictions on how the software can be modified, there is a risk that modified
versions of the software may contain malware or other security vulnerabilities. This can be particularly problematic for
organizations that rely on software for critical business operations or for individuals who use the software for sensitive
personal information.
5. EXAMPLES OF PUBLIC DOMAIN SOFTWARE
1. GNU: GNU is a collection of software programs developed by the Free Software Foundation. The software is
released under a combination of different open source licenses and is available for free download. Some of the most
popular components of the GNU collection include the GNU Compiler Collection (GCC) and the GNU Debugger
(GDB).
2. Linux: Linux is an open source operating system that was originally developed by Linus Torvalds in 1991. The
operating system is widely used on servers, desktop computers, and mobile devices, and has been adapted for use
in a wide range of different applications.
3. Apache: Apache is an open source web server that is widely used to host websites and web applications. The
software was first released in 1995 and is maintained by the Apache Software Foundation. Apache is known for its
stability, scalability, and security, and is used by many of the world’s largest websites.
6. CONCLUSION
• In conclusion, public domain software plays an important role in the modern technology landscape.
By eliminating legal restrictions on how software can be used, modified, and distributed, public
domain software provides a high degree of flexibility and cost savings for individuals and
organizations. However, there are also potential downsides to using public domain software,
including a lack of support, potential legal issues, and quality control concerns.